Resources for seniors in Watertown, MA
Springwell Inc., located in Watertown, MA, is a dedicated Area Agency on Aging that serves as the essential first point of contact for seniors seeking information about long-term care options. The agency's compassionate staff, comprised of social workers and registered nurses, assists families in navigating the complexities of caregiving and decision-making. Springwell conducts functional needs assessments and offers care coordination services to empower seniors to maintain their independence in the least restrictive environments possible. In addition to its comprehensive resources, which include a lending library with over 300 age-related programs, the agency provides vital support services such as transportation, shopping assistance, and escorts for medical appointments. Furthermore, an ombudsman is available to address questions and concerns regarding assisted living facilities and nursing homes, ensuring that seniors receive the guidance they need for their well-being. For more information or assistance, individuals can reach Springwell Inc. at (617) 926-4100.
The Watertown Council on Aging and Senior Center, located in Watertown, MA, is a dedicated local government agency providing a diverse array of social and recreational services tailored for older adults. Seniors are encouraged to engage in a vibrant community atmosphere through various activities such as fitness classes, book clubs, knitting circles, and day trips. Among the center's popular offerings are tai chi, chair yoga, and line dancing sessions that promote both physical health and social interaction. In addition to recreational programs, the Council on Aging extends vital support services including Medicare insurance counseling, tax preparation assistance, senior transportation options, and free blood pressure checks to ensure the well-being of Watertown's elderly population. For more information or to get involved, you can reach the center at (617) 972-6490.
MetroWest Legal Services, located in Watertown, MA, offers invaluable support to seniors in the community by providing free legal advice and information, thanks to funding from Springwell and the Older Americans Act. Through its Senior Citizen's Legal Project, individuals can receive assistance with a variety of legal matters including housing, government benefits, bankruptcy, health care proxies, estate planning, and conservatorship proceedings. This vital service is delivered by a dedicated team of volunteer and staff attorneys who are committed to helping older adults navigate their legal challenges effectively. For more information or to access these services, seniors can reach out via phone at (508) 620-1830.
The Watertown Veteran's Service Officer, located in Watertown, MA, serves as a vital resource for military families throughout the state. As part of the Massachusetts Department of Veterans' Services, this local office provides outreach and assistance to veterans and their dependents, guiding them through the application process for a variety of state and federal benefits. This encompasses essential services such as VA health care, pensions, disability benefits, and personal care programs like the Aid & Attendance benefit. Additionally, veterans may be eligible for free medical transportation and various tax breaks. For support and information, individuals can reach out to the Watertown VSO at (617) 972-4616.
Considerations for seniors living in Watertown, MA
Proximity to Boston: Watertown is just a few miles away from Boston's cultural and historical attractions. Seniors can benefit from easy access to museums, theaters, and art galleries.
Healthcare: There are several world-class hospitals located in the area, including Massachusetts General Hospital and Brigham and Women's Hospital. Seniors can receive high-quality medical care when needed.
Outdoor activities: Watertown is home to several parks and natural reserves where seniors can enjoy walking trails, birdwatching, or picnicking with their families.
Senior centers: The town has senior centers that offer a variety of activities like games, dances, exercise classes, and educational programs.
Accessible transportation: The town has public transportation options like buses and trains that make it easier for seniors to travel around the area without needing a car.
Active adult communities: There are several active adult communities in Watertown that offer amenities like community spaces, walking trails, fitness centers, and social events specifically designed for seniors.
Cultural diversity: The town has a strong immigrant population from different ethnic backgrounds which enriches the local culture with various festivals throughout the year perfect for seniors who love experiencing new cultures.
Affordable cost of living: Compared to other areas around Boston such as Cambridge or Newton where housing costs are very high due to their proximity to major academic institutions; Watertown offers more affordable housing options catering better to seniors with fixed budgets or retirement savings plans.
